#a441f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a441f5 is composed of 64.3% red, 25.5%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.1% cyan, 73.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 273 degrees, a saturation of 90% and a lightness of 60.8%. #a441f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#4900eb.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#a441f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a441f5 has RGB values of R:164, G:65,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10764789.
